MG S5 EV vs Škoda Elroq

Biggest differences: Power — MG S5 EV 231 PS, Škoda Elroq 286 PS · Weight — MG S5 EV 1680 kg, Škoda Elroq 2050 kg · Battery — MG S5 EV 64 kWh, Škoda Elroq 77 kWh.

MG S5 EV

The MG S5 EV is an all-electric SUV in the C segment, offering two rear-wheel drive (RWD) variants with different battery capacities and motor power outputs.

Škoda Elroq

The Škoda Elroq is a compact SUV in the C-segment, offering rear-wheel drive or all-wheel drive options, and power outputs ranging from 170 to 340 horsepower.

Frequently asked questions about this comparison

Which has the longer range — MG S5 EV or Škoda Elroq?

The Škoda Elroq goes further: 573 km WLTP against the 480 km of the MG S5 EV. That is a difference of 93 km.

Which one can power appliances from a socket (V2L)?

Only the MG S5 EV — its 64 kWh battery then works as a power source. The Škoda Elroq, with 77 kWh, does not offer it.

Which charges faster?

The MG S5 EV accepts up to 139 kW DC, the Škoda Elroq up to 135 kW. Charging from 10 to 80% takes 28 and 28 min respectively.

Range, consumption and weight are given for the base configuration: manufacturers homologate them as a band of values that depends on wheels and equipment (e.g. 533–592 km), and we take the lightest variant, on the smallest wheels — i.e. the most favourable. The same model on larger wheels will travel a shorter distance.
